How does complaining affect relationships?
interpersonal relationship
Complaining can have negative effects Our friendships and work connections Too. « We can distance ourselves from each other over time, » Tickner said. « We no longer found the other person to be safe or attractive, so we started to figure out ways to avoid contact. »
Does complaining make things worse?
So while your life may not experience any objective changes, Complaining makes your subjective experience of life worse. And you may actually experience some objectively worse outcomes in your life because complaining tends to lower the likelihood of positive action.

Why is it bad to complain?
when you complain increase your cortisol levels, also known as the stress hormone. Chronically high levels of cortisol can lead to a variety of health problems, including an increased risk of depression, digestive problems, sleep problems, high blood pressure, and even an increased risk of heart disease.

Why is one never satisfied?
Hedonic adaptation is the tendency of humans to quickly adapt to major positive or negative life events or changes and return to a basic level of well-being. As a person achieves more success, expectations and desires also increase.The result is never feel Satisfaction – not attaining permanent happiness.
